awstats - 如何让 AWstats 分析旧日志文件?

标签 awstats

我有很多旧的日志文件(apache),它们跨越我拥有的 3 个不同的 VPS 服务器,因此有不同的组具有相同的名称:

旧 vps 1(2012 年 1 月 - 2012 年 3 月)-> access.log.1.gz

旧 vps 2(2012 年 4 月 - 2012 年 10 月)-> access.log.1.gz

等等..

是否有 awstats 命令可以分析所有旧日志文件并生成具有正确日期的报告?在运行命令之前我是否需要对文件进行压缩或重命名?

最佳答案

您可以使用 logresolvemerge.pl 工具(请参阅 FAQ-COM350 )。您可以更改 .conf 文件中的 LogFile 选项,或者(对于一次性运行)将其用作更新中的参数。

LogFile="/path/to/logresolvemerge.pl access.log* |"

命令行更新的示例(在基于 debian 的系统上):

/usr/lib/cgi-bin/awstats.pl -update -config="example.com" -LogFile="/usr/share/awstats/tools/logresolvemerge.pl /var/log/apache2/access.log* |"

备注:您可能需要清理现有的统计数据。请参阅FAQ-COM500

关于awstats - 如何让 AWstats 分析旧日志文件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13832701/

相关文章:

html - AWStats 额外部分列宽

linux - 服务器因 RAM 使用率过高而不断崩溃 - 实时 IP 监控?

perl - 如何从批处理文件将参数传递给perl脚本

geoip - maxmind geolite city 精度不断降低

php - 解析 Webalizer 或/和 AWstats html 文件

performance - 使用 ubuntu 13.10 在 apache2 中安装 awstats

apache - Debian 10 上的 Awstats - 访问次数太少 - 修复它的选项

ubuntu - 如何将 awstats 与 OpenLiteSpeed WebAdmin 一起使用?

AWStats 7 下载 - 206 次点击

statistics - 使用 Awstats 生成 Liferay 门户的使用统计信息